About Upper Chinkui Village

Upper Chinkui is a small village in Dadam tehsil, in the district of Tirap, Arunachal Pradesh. The Census of India 2011 recorded a population of 268, made up of 135 males and 133 females. That works out to a sex ratio of about 985 females per 1000 males. Its pincode is 786630, shared with the other villages in the same post office area.
